MeliBio
Pre Seed Round in 2021
MeliBio, Inc. is a technology-driven company based in Oakland, California, founded in 2020 by Aaron M. Schaller, PhD, and Darko Mandich. The company specializes in producing vegan nectar products that serve as a molecularly identical alternative to traditional honey. By employing advancements in plant biology, precision fermentation, and synthetic biology, MeliBio creates honey without the involvement of bees, aiming to mitigate the negative impact of commercial bee farming on biodiversity. In 2023, MeliBio launched its consumer-facing brand, Mellody, further expanding its market presence. Recognized by TIME as one of the Best Inventions of 2021, MeliBio is committed to providing sustainable and innovative solutions in the food industry.

Digbi Health
Convertible Note in 2020
Digbi Health specializes in digital therapeutics, offering personalized health programs for conditions like obesity, type 2 diabetes, gastrointestinal issues, and mental health. It uses precision biology, including genetics and gut microbiome analysis, to tailor care. The company provides an online platform tracking key metrics and offers virtual clinics prescribing GLP drugs.
GOURMEY
Venture Round in 2019
Founded in Paris, France in 2019, GOURMEY specializes in developing and producing ethical foie gras using duck cell cultivation. This innovative process aims to create sustainable, high-quality meat products without force-feeding or animal slaughter.

Solarea Bio
Seed Round in 2018
Solarea Bio is a biotechnology company that develops microbial therapeutics derived from healthy food sources. It uses computational approaches to create synergistic combinations of bacteria, fungi, and prebiotic fibers with anti-inflammatory properties, targeting chronic health conditions such as osteopenia and osteoporosis in postmenopausal women.
